Skip to content

[3.6] bpo-31804: Fix multiprocessing.Process with broken standard streams (GH-6079)#6081

Merged
pitrou merged 1 commit into
python:3.6from
pitrou:backport-e756f66-3.6
Mar 11, 2018
Merged

[3.6] bpo-31804: Fix multiprocessing.Process with broken standard streams (GH-6079)#6081
pitrou merged 1 commit into
python:3.6from
pitrou:backport-e756f66-3.6

Conversation

@pitrou

@pitrou pitrou commented Mar 11, 2018

Copy link
Copy Markdown
Member

In some conditions the standard streams will be None or closed in the child process (for example if using "pythonw" instead of "python" on Windows). Avoid failing with a non-0 exit code in those conditions.

Report and initial patch by poxthegreat..
(cherry picked from commit e756f66)

https://bugs.python.org/issue31804

…eams (pythonGH-6079)

In some conditions the standard streams will be None or closed in the child process (for example if using "pythonw" instead of "python" on Windows).  Avoid failing with a non-0 exit code in those conditions.

Report and initial patch by poxthegreat..
(cherry picked from commit e756f66)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ants